croome international (formerly david croome limited) has been a british company since 1972, but since around 1999 have operated trucks registered in lithuania (where they have an office) and more recently in ukraine, serbia and possibly other EE countries - they have just one UK driver left i understand.david’s brother michael split from the company a few years back and runs about 10 trucks as croome logistics, same livery etc, out of freightflow depot at lenham doing EU and swiss work - hope that helps, asking for any particular reason robinhood?
